Regency Brass Inlaid Rosewood Tea Caddy
![](http://images.antiquesatlas.com/dealer-stock-images/grahamsmithantiques/Regency_Brass_Inlaid_Rosewood__as102a5916b.jpg)
![](http://antiquesatlas.com/images/loading_new.gif)
Description
An early 19th century Regency rosewood and brass inlaid tea caddy.The caddy has a hinged lid that opens to a red velvet lined interior with two tea canisters and a glass sugar or mixing bowl.
The canisters have hinged lids with rosewood veneer and brass inlays and are mahogany lined.
The caddy has decorative gilt brass ring handles to the sides and is raised on turned rosewood ball feet.
This very nice caddy is in good condition, the glass bowl is an old replacement. (Circa 1820)
Height 19cm (7.5 inches)
Width 31.5cm (12.4 inches)
Depth 15.3cm (6 inches)
